General Information about Deep Koamaru
The hex color #251682, also known as Deep Koamaru, is a dark shade of blue-violet. It belongs to the family of blue hues, characterized by a strong presence of blue and a subtle hint of red. In the RGB color model, it is composed of 14.51% red, 8.63% green, and 50.98% blue. In the CMYK color model, it consists of 71.54% cyan, 83.05% magenta, 0% yellow, and 49.02% black. The color #251682, also known as Deep Koamaru, presents several accessibility considerations for web developers. Its dark hue results in a low luminance value, which directly impacts text legibility. When used as a background color, sufficient contrast with text is crucial. According to WCAG guidelines, the contrast ratio between text and background should be at least 4.5:1 for normal text and 3:1 for large text (14pt bold or 18pt regular). Developers must verify that any text rendered on a #251682 background meets these contrast requirements to ensure readability for users with visual impairments. Tools like contrast checkers can aid in this verification process. Furthermore, relying solely on color to convey information should be avoided. Always provide alternative cues, such as text labels or icons, to ensure content is accessible to users who are color blind or have other visual limitations. Careful consideration of these factors is essential for creating inclusive and accessible web experiences.

Applications
Web Design
In web design, Deep Koamaru can be used as a primary color for a website with a sophisticated and mysterious theme. It works well for backgrounds, headers, and accents, especially when paired with lighter text colors like white or light gray to ensure readability. It's suitable for websites related to technology, security, or luxury goods where a sense of depth and intrigue is desired. The color can also be incorporated into user interface elements like buttons and progress bars to create a consistent visual experience. Remember to use it sparingly and strategically to avoid overwhelming the user.
